Intervention is a show where producers and a camera crew follow addicts around under the guise of making a documentary about addiction. They cover the person's life before addiction and try to cover what lead them to this life. At the last interview they sit the family down with an intervention expert and then confront the addict about their addiction. If the addict agrees to go to treatment the show will pay for it.

Robby Pardlo is a Grammy nominated R&B artist who preformed with the group City High he formed with two high school friends. After his girlfriend who was also in the group married their other group mate. City High broke up and Robby became addicted to alcohol and with his over supportive girlfriend he could maintain his addiction. He decides to go to treatment during the intervention.

He's just a drunk who has always had a support structure so he's just going to continue the same way. His mother turns a blind eye to everything he does. The mothers oldest son has two daughters that she's only seen twice because she spends so much time dealing with Robby. Then Robby focus his personal anger on his mother for divorcing his father a few years ago after they were all grown. He's projecting his hurt for losing his girlfriend to his group mate onto his parents. He can't see that single hurt is ruling his life because he's masking it with alcohol.

Top Addict Moment - He's trying to record back up vocals for a new group in a basement studio and he's drinking as he's poorly singing. Each time they have him sing again because he made a mistake he takes a drink. He walks out of the recording booth and he's sweating and his shirt is drenched.

The Intervention - With his family gathered they bring him in and he knows what is going on right away. They sit him down and he gets upset then he stands up because, "I want to see everyone." He watches a few more people read letters about him and his addiction and he agrees to go to treatment.
